Purified Membrane Protein Market Overview

The Purified Membrane Protein Market is expanding as demand increases for purified membrane proteins in biopharmaceutical development, drug discovery, diagnostics, structural biology, and vaccine research. Growing investment in biotechnology and pharmaceutical R&D, rising demand for novel therapeutics, advances in protein isolation and purification technologies, and increasing use of membrane proteins in diagnostic assays are supporting market growth.

According to the Wise Guy Reports market report published December 19, 2025, the global Purified Membrane Protein Market was valued at USD 2.1534 Billion in 2024 and is projected to grow from USD 2.315 Billion in 2025 to USD 4.8 Billion by 2035, registering a CAGR of 7.5% during 2025–2035. North America is expected to lead the market, with its market value projected to increase from USD 0.9 Billion in 2024 to USD 1.9 Billion by 2035. Biopharmaceuticals represented the largest application area, valued at USD 1.0 Billion in 2024 and projected to reach USD 2.1 Billion by 2035.

The market is being shaped by growing demand for biopharmaceuticals, increasing applications of membrane proteins in drug development, advances in purification techniques, rising R&D investments, and expanding use in diagnostic assays. Membrane proteins are increasingly important in therapeutic development, particularly in areas involving receptors, ion channels, transporters, and other complex biological targets. Automation and high-throughput technologies are also improving the efficiency, consistency, and accessibility of membrane protein production and analysis.

The Purified Membrane Protein Market can be segmented by Application into Biopharmaceuticals, Research and Development, Diagnostics, and Food and Beverage Processing. By Source, it includes Animal-derived, Plant-derived, and Microbial-derived. By Purification Method, it covers Chromatography, Ultrafiltration, Precipitation, and Electrophoresis. By End Use, it includes Pharmaceutical Companies, Academic Research Institutions, Food Industry, and Biotechnology Companies. By Region, the market covers North America, Europe, South America, Asia-Pacific, and the Middle East & Africa.

Recent Developments and Market Trends:

Advances in membrane filtration and purification technologies are improving protein recovery efficiency, yield, stability, and scalability.

Automation and high-throughput technologies are gaining adoption as researchers and biopharmaceutical manufacturers seek more standardized and efficient protein production and analysis.

Biopharmaceutical research is increasing demand for purified membrane proteins used in therapeutic development, vaccine research, diagnostics, and drug discovery.

Plant-derived and microbial-derived membrane proteins are gaining attention as researchers explore sustainable and alternative protein sources alongside established animal-derived sources.

Academic and industry collaborations are supporting innovation in purification techniques and the development of new membrane-protein-based technologies.

AI and machine learning are emerging as tools for optimizing purification processes, identifying production bottlenecks, and improving manufacturing efficiency.
